Recipe for Roasted Broccoli con Pomodoro
Why roasted broccoli? Do you ever get in a rut with what you're cooking? I do. With our weekly veggie delivery and a conscious effort to get more veggies in our diet, I've gotten in the habit of steaming almost everything. Which in and of itself isn't bad. Steaming is one of the best ways to keep calories down and retain the most nutrients. But, it gets boring!
So...I've been trying to branch out and tonight I put together a simple but very tasty Italian flavored dish. The flavor of the roasted broccoli is amazingly complex, intense, and almost sweet. The addition of garlic, tomato, and a small amount of good cheese creates a perfect dish!
I'm committed to trying to be more creative with my veggies. How about you?
